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Anna Paul’s Viral Turkish Pasta Step 1: Prepare Garlic Yogurt In a m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of Greek yogurt, 4 grated garlic cloves, juice from ½ lemon, and a pinch of salt. Whisk together until smooth and creamy, ensuring the garlic is evenly distributed. Set this aromatic garlic yogurt aside to allow the flavors to meld while you prepare the rest of the ingredients. Step 2: Cook Spiced Beef Heat a large skillet over medium heat and add a splash of olive oil. Sauté 1 diced yellow onion for 2-3 minutes until it becomes soft and translucent. Sprinkle in 2 teaspoons of sweet paprika, 1 teaspoon of garlic powder, and ½ teaspoon of cumin, stirring for about 2 minutes until fragrant. Add 1 lb of ground beef, browning it for 8-10 minutes until fully cooked, then mix in 3 tablespoons of tomato paste and simmer for another 2-3 minutes. Step 3: Make Paprika Butter In a small saucepan, melt ¼ cup of butter over low heat. Once melted, stir in 2 teaspoons of sweet paprika, allowing it to gently bubble for a minute until the flavors infuse into the butter. Remove the saucepan from heat, letting it cool slightly while you assemble the pasta dish. Step 4: Cook the Pasta While preparing the beef and butter, cook 12 oz of your chosen pasta (like fusilli or penne) according to package instructions until al dente, usually around 8-10 minutes. Drain the pasta in a colander, then return it to the pot, creating a warm base for mixing in the flavorful beef. Step 5: Assemble and Serve Combine the cooked pasta with the spiced beef mixture in the pot, tossing well to ensure the pasta is coated with the savory flavors. Serve portions in bowls, topping each with the creamy garlic yogurt and drizzling the warm paprika butter generously over the top. Garnish with halved cherry tomatoes, crumbled feta cheese, and freshly chopped parsley for an inviting presentation. You can prepare the garlic yogurt and paprika butter up to 24 hours in advance—just store each in separate airtight containers in the refrigerator to maintain their creamy texture. The spiced beef can be cooked ahead and refrigerated, keeping well for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to serve, simply reheat the beef mixture and cook the pasta fresh for optimal texture. Expert Tips for Anna Paul’s Viral Turkish Pasta Quality Counts: Use high-quality Greek yogurt for richer flavors. It enhances the creaminess of the garlic yogurt and elevates the overall dish. Spice It Up: Don’t hesitate to adjust the spices to your liking. A touch more paprika or a dash of chili flakes can kick it up a notch! Cooking Order: Sauté onions and spices before adding the ground beef. This helps release aromatic oils, resulting in a deeper flavor profile for the beef sauce. Pasta Perfect: Cook the pasta just until al dente. It’ll continue to cook slightly when mixed with the hot beef mixture, preventing it from becoming mushy. Prep Ahead: Prepare the garlic yogurt and paprika butter in advance and refrigerate. This saves time and enhances flavor depth when you assemble the dish. Storage Tips for Anna Paul’s Viral Turkish Pasta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Keep the garlic yogurt and paprika butter separate to maintain their creamy textures. Freezer: Freeze the pasta without the garlic yogurt and paprika butter for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. Reheating: Gently reheat the pasta in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of water or broth to revive its moisture. Serve with fresh garlic yogurt and paprika butter once warmed. When ready to enjoy, thaw it overnight in the fridge and reheat gently in a skillet with a splash of water or broth. What can I do if my ground beef is too dry? If you find that your ground beef is too dry, try adding a bit more tomato paste or a splash of beef broth while cooking. This will help to moisten the meat and integrate more flavorful juices back into the dish. Are there any dietary considerations to keep in mind? Indeed!
